uploadFile
将本地资源上传至云存储空间,如果上传至同一路径则是覆盖。
请求参数
| 字段 | 说明 | 数据类型 | 默认值 | 必填 |
|---|---|---|---|---|
| cloudPath | 云存储路径 | String | – | Y |
| fileContent | 要上传文件的内容 | fs.ReadStream | – | Y |
Promise返回结果说明
| 字段 | 说明 | 数据类型 |
|---|---|---|
| fileID | 文件 ID | String |
| statusCode | 服务器返回的 HTTP 状态码 | Number |
错误返回参数
| 字段 | 说明 | 数据类型 |
|---|---|---|
| errCode | 错误码 | Number |
| errMsg | 错误信息,格式 apiName:fail msg | String |
使用示例
Promise 风格
const cloud = require('wx-server-sdk')
const fs = require('fs')
const path = require('path')
exports.main = async (event, context) => {
const fileStream = fs.createReadStream(path.join(__dirname, 'demo.jpg'))
return await cloud.uploadFile({
cloudPath: 'demo.jpg',
fileContent: fileStream,
})
}


![晴川云Minecraft Wiki教程:初始资源[ ],晴川云](https://baike.qcidc.com/wp-content/uploads/2025/09/20250919082144706-u_2038185798_1538378297fm_253fmt_autoapp_138f_PNG.png)







暂无评论内容